40 year mortgage interest rates The tradeoff of a lower payment with the 40 year mortgage comes at a price, it is offset by a higher interest rate, typically .25% to .50% higher than that of the 30 year fixed rate mortgage. The real savings, in actual percentage terms, with a 40 year payment versus other loans can be deceiving.

How to Pay Your Mortgage Faster: 13 Steps (with Pictures) – You can also pay your mortgage every 2 weeks as opposed to once a month, which will help you pay off an extra month every year. Or, whenever you get a bonus or tax refund, you could put it toward your mortgage to lower your principal balance. Also, consider rounding up your payments to pay your mortgage faster.

How to Lower Your Mortgage Payments – Meet with your insurance agent to see if there are any ways to lower your homeowner’s insurance premiums that you might have missed. Here are some discounts to ask about. Just raising your deductible to $1,000 is often enough to cut your premiums by 40%, so this could really help you get your monthly mortgage payment down.

How to Lower Your Monthly Mortgage Payments – Mortgage payments are monthly payments you will pay to your lender in order to gradually pay off the total sum of your home loan. The size of the monthly payments is determined by the size of the principal at the beginning (the loan minus the down payment) and the term within which the loan must be repaid.
